Thanks Niels but I am not sure that is the fault..
I now get the error:
org.xml.sax.SAXParseException: The value of attribute "action"
associated with an
element type "ft:form-template" must not contain the '<' character.
when I try and use the CDATA wrapper in the stylesheet:
<ft:form-template action="<![CDATA[#{$continuation/id}.continue}]]>"
method="POST">
I think there might be a deeper problem.
That's invalid XML. If this is in an XSLT (and I think it is, since your
original error was a TransformerException), try
<ft:form-template method="POST">
<xsl:attribute
name="action"><![CDATA[#{$continuation/id}.continue}]]></xsl:attribute>
</ft:form-template>
This works for me.

Working with Cocoon 2.1.8
I am getting the following error when I try to reference the
continuation variable, used for the form action.
javax.xml.transform.TransformerException: Could not find variable
with the name of continuation
Basically, I am calling the form creation match via flowscript,
followed by a call to the form display match. (Very standard
stuff).
Each of these matches then generates the form definition and
template (respectively) using information sourced from a database.
If I take the result from each of the two matches ie. one XML file
with the form definition and one with the form template, and then
call these static files in similar way from flowscript, the
continuation
number is generated as expected.
How do I go about creating/referencing a continuation with a dynamic
form creation option?
Not sure but the error you see might be caused by a # or $ in
"#{$cocoon/continuation/id}" getting lost in the dynamic form creation
process, so if that is the case try putting it inside CDATA, e.g.
<![CDATA[#{$cocoon/continuation/id}]]>
